以文本方式查看主题

-  金字塔客服中心 - 专业程序化交易软件提供商  (http://weistock.com/bbs/index.asp)
--  公式模型编写问题提交  (http://weistock.com/bbs/list.asp?boardid=4)
----  后台套利总是有单腿或多开单  (http://weistock.com/bbs/dispbbs.asp?boardid=4&id=87124)

--  作者:plsf99
--  发布时间:2015/11/10 9:45:27
--  后台套利总是有单腿或多开单

2015-11-10 09:25:56.527    【后台】TF00 运行结束
2015-11-10 09:26:16.794    【后台】T00 TBuy 第 41 行出现信号
2015-11-10 09:26:16.794    【后台】TF00 TBuy 已成功触发下单操作 价格:97.474998 数量:10 类型:0 账户:606959 品种:TF00
2015-11-10 09:26:16.794    【后台】启用多帐户及策略系数配置
2015-11-10 09:26:16.794    【后台】多账户及策略系数 委托账户或者组: 606959
2015-11-10 09:26:16.794    【后台】CTP登录账户 0 个
2015-11-10 09:26:16.794    【后台】金仕达登录账户 0 个
2015-11-10 09:26:16.794    【后台】恒生登录账户 0 个
2015-11-10 09:26:16.794    【后台】子账户 登录账户 0 个
2015-11-10 09:26:16.794    【后台】扩展接口 登录账户 1 个
2015-11-10 09:26:16.794    【后台】 分帐户 606959 下单
2015-11-10 09:26:16.809    【后台】账户 606959 下单系数为1.000000
2015-11-10 09:26:16.809    【后台】账户 606959 下单,系数调整后下单量:10
2015-11-10 09:26:16.809    【后台】下单已发送
2015-11-10 09:26:16.825    【后台】T00 运行结束
2015-11-10 09:26:16.981    【后台】TF00 TBuy 第 41 行出现信号
2015-11-10 09:26:16.981    【后台】TF00 TBuy 已成功触发下单操作 价格:99.199997 数量:10 类型:0 账户:606959 品种:TF00
2015-11-10 09:26:16.981    【后台】启用多帐户及策略系数配置
2015-11-10 09:26:16.981    【后台】多账户及策略系数 委托账户或者组: 606959
2015-11-10 09:26:16.981    【后台】CTP登录账户 0 个
2015-11-10 09:26:16.981    【后台】金仕达登录账户 0 个
2015-11-10 09:26:16.981    【后台】恒生登录账户 0 个
2015-11-10 09:26:16.996    【后台】子账户 登录账户 0 个
2015-11-10 09:26:16.996    【后台】扩展接口 登录账户 1 个
2015-11-10 09:26:16.996    【后台】 分帐户 606959 下单
2015-11-10 09:26:16.996    【后台】账户 606959 下单系数为1.000000
2015-11-10 09:26:16.996    【后台】账户 606959 下单,系数调整后下单量:10
2015-11-10 09:26:16.996    【后台】下单已发送
2015-11-10 09:26:17.386    【后台】TF00 运行结束
2015-11-10 09:26:17.386    【回报】品种 TF12 委托价格 97.475 超过涨跌停版限制
2015-11-10 09:26:17.386    【下单】TF12 价99.199997 量10 买卖0 类型0 开平0 账户606959 Formula 1
2015-11-10 09:26:17.402    【指令】收到回报指令 ID = -1863906485
2015-11-10 09:26:17.402    【回报】606959 : TF1512 - 已报单 10 价格:99.200 开 买
2015-11-10 09:26:17.433    【指令】收到回报指令 ID = -1863906485
2015-11-10 09:26:22.866    【追单】发送了首次追单下单指令到队列 追单数量:10 账户606959 报单:10 成交0
2015-11-10 09:26:22.866    【追单】追单队列 撤单操作 订单号:-1863906485 账户:606959
2015-11-10 09:26:22.897    【指令】收到回报指令 ID = -1863906485
2015-11-10 09:26:22.928    【回报】606959 : TF12 5年国债1512 - 已撤单 量:10
2015-11-10 09:26:22.928    【下单】TF12 价99.205002 量10 买卖0 类型0 开平0 账户606959 Formula 1
2015-11-10 09:26:22.928    【指令】收到回报指令 ID = -1863906485
2015-11-10 09:26:22.944    【追单】撤单成功,发送追单指令
2015-11-10 09:26:22.991    【指令】收到回报指令 ID = -1863906484
2015-11-10 09:26:23.006    【回报】606959 : TF1512 - 已报单 10 价格:99.205 开 买
2015-11-10 09:26:23.006    【指令】收到回报指令 ID = -1863906484
2015-11-10 09:26:23.006    【指令】收到回报指令 ID = -1863906484
2015-11-10 09:26:23.022    【指令】收到成交回报指令 ORDERID = -1863906484
2015-11-10 09:26:23.039    【回报】606959 : TF1512 - 已成交 5 价格:99.205 开 买
2015-11-10 09:26:23.039    【指令】收到回报指令 ID = -1863906484
2015-11-10 09:26:23.049    【指令】收到成交回报指令 ORDERID = -1863906484
2015-11-10 09:26:23.069    【回报】606959 : TF1512 - 已成交 5 价格:99.205 开 买
2015-11-10 09:26:23.069    【回报】606959 : TF1512 - 全部成交 10

 

跨品种中,流动性不太好的品种总是出现单腿和多开单,有什么解决办法吗?

2015-11-10 09:26:17.386    【回报】品种 TF12 委托价格 97.475 超过涨跌停版限制 // 象这条,TF委托价格下成了T的价格


--  作者:jinzhe
--  发布时间:2015/11/10 9:52:34
--  
你在T合约的监控下用T合约的价格给TF下单?
--  作者:plsf99
--  发布时间:2015/11/10 10:03:54
--  
后台套利模拟,两个合约都监控了,TF经常以T的价格下单,而T的委托有时候不下,有时候又多下,比如规定下6手,结果有18手成交.
--  作者:jinzhe
--  发布时间:2015/11/10 10:12:02
--  

给不是当前监控合约下单的时候,要引用价格,

比如你的策略在TF下面跑,然后要给T下单,那么先引用好T的价格,在用引用的T价格下单


--  作者:plsf99
--  发布时间:2015/11/10 10:20:26
--  

TBUYSHORT(Tsellholding(0)=0,lots1,LMT,DYNAINFO(28),0,账户,套利品种1 );
TBUY(Tbuyholding(0)=0,lots2,LMT,DYNAINFO(34),0,账户,套利品种2 );

这不是已经指定了品种吗?


--  作者:jinzhe
--  发布时间:2015/11/10 10:26:37
--  

你指定的是品种, 但是没有指定价格啊,还有持仓也要改改。比如你这个策略是在TF上跑的,那么都是用TF的价格和持仓

 

TBUYSHORT(Tsellholding2(\'\',套利品种1,0)=0,lots1,LMT,DYNAINFO2(28,套利品种1),0,账户,套利品种1 );
TBUY(Tbuyholding2(\'\',套利品种2,0)=0,lots2,LMT,DYNAINFO2(34,套利品种2),0,账户,套利品种2 );

 

这样改

[此贴子已经被作者于2015/11/10 10:27:15编辑过]

--  作者:plsf99
--  发布时间:2015/11/10 10:31:21
--  
哦,谢谢,这后台参数太复杂,帮助文件又太简单图片点击可在新窗口打开查看
--  作者:plsf99
--  发布时间:2015/11/10 10:35:15
--  
2015-11-10 10:32:00.263    【后台】T00 TBuyShort 第 30 行出现信号
2015-11-10 10:32:00.263    【后台】TF00 TBuyShort 已成功触发下单操作 价格:97.485001 数量:10 类型:0 账户:606959 品种:TF00
2015-11-10 10:32:00.263    【后台】启用多帐户及策略系数配置
2015-11-10 10:32:00.263    【后台】多账户及策略系数 委托账户或者组: 606959
2015-11-10 10:32:00.263    【后台】CTP登录账户 0 个
2015-11-10 10:32:00.263    【后台】金仕达登录账户 0 个
2015-11-10 10:32:00.263    【后台】恒生登录账户 0 个
2015-11-10 10:32:00.263    【后台】子账户 登录账户 0 个
2015-11-10 10:32:00.263    【后台】扩展接口 登录账户 1 个
2015-11-10 10:32:00.263    【后台】 分帐户 606959 下单
2015-11-10 10:32:00.279    【后台】账户 606959 下单系数为1.000000
2015-11-10 10:32:00.279    【后台】账户 606959 下单,系数调整后下单量:10
2015-11-10 10:32:00.279    【后台】下单已发送
2015-11-10 10:32:00.279    【后台】T00 TBuy 第 31 行出现信号
2015-11-10 10:32:00.279    【后台】T00 TBuy 已成功触发下单操作 价格:97.489998 数量:7 类型:0 账户:606959 品种:T00
2015-11-10 10:32:00.279    【后台】启用多帐户及策略系数配置
2015-11-10 10:32:00.279    【后台】多账户及策略系数 委托账户或者组: 606959
2015-11-10 10:32:00.279    【后台】CTP登录账户 0 个
2015-11-10 10:32:00.279    【后台】金仕达登录账户 0 个
2015-11-10 10:32:00.279    【后台】恒生登录账户 0 个
2015-11-10 10:32:00.294    【后台】子账户 登录账户 0 个
2015-11-10 10:32:00.294    【后台】扩展接口 登录账户 1 个
2015-11-10 10:32:00.294    【后台】 分帐户 606959 下单
2015-11-10 10:32:00.294    【后台】账户 606959 下单系数为1.000000
2015-11-10 10:32:00.294    【后台】账户 606959 下单,系数调整后下单量:7
2015-11-10 10:32:00.294    【后台】下单已发送
2015-11-10 10:32:00.310    【后台】T00 运行结束
2015-11-10 10:32:00.482    【后台】TF00 TBuyShort 第 30 行出现信号
2015-11-10 10:32:00.482    【后台】TF00 TBuyShort 已成功触发下单操作 价格:99.224998 数量:10 类型:0 账户:606959 品种:TF00
2015-11-10 10:32:00.482    【后台】启用多帐户及策略系数配置
2015-11-10 10:32:00.482    【后台】多账户及策略系数 委托账户或者组: 606959
2015-11-10 10:32:00.482    【后台】CTP登录账户 0 个
2015-11-10 10:32:00.482    【后台】金仕达登录账户 0 个
2015-11-10 10:32:00.482    【后台】恒生登录账户 0 个
2015-11-10 10:32:00.482    【后台】子账户 登录账户 0 个
2015-11-10 10:32:00.482    【后台】扩展接口 登录账户 1 个
2015-11-10 10:32:00.497    【后台】 分帐户 606959 下单
2015-11-10 10:32:00.497    【后台】账户 606959 下单系数为1.000000
2015-11-10 10:32:00.497    【后台】账户 606959 下单,系数调整后下单量:10
2015-11-10 10:32:00.497    【后台】下单已发送
2015-11-10 10:32:00.497    【后台】TF00 TBuy 第 31 行出现信号
2015-11-10 10:32:00.497    【后台】T00 TBuy 已成功触发下单操作 价格:99.230003 数量:7 类型:0 账户:606959 品种:T00
2015-11-10 10:32:00.497    【后台】启用多帐户及策略系数配置
2015-11-10 10:32:00.497    【后台】多账户及策略系数 委托账户或者组: 606959
2015-11-10 10:32:00.497    【后台】CTP登录账户 0 个
2015-11-10 10:32:00.497    【后台】金仕达登录账户 0 个
2015-11-10 10:32:00.497    【后台】恒生登录账户 0 个
2015-11-10 10:32:00.497    【后台】子账户 登录账户 0 个
2015-11-10 10:32:00.513    【后台】扩展接口 登录账户 1 个
2015-11-10 10:32:00.513    【后台】 分帐户 606959 下单
2015-11-10 10:32:00.513    【后台】账户 606959 下单系数为1.000000
2015-11-10 10:32:00.513    【后台】账户 606959 下单,系数调整后下单量:7
2015-11-10 10:32:00.513    【后台】下单已发送
2015-11-10 10:32:00.513    【后台】TF00 运行结束
2015-11-10 10:32:00.513    【下单】T12 价97.489998 量7 买卖0 类型0 开平0 账户606959 Formula 1
2015-11-10 10:32:00.513    【回报】品种 TF12 委托价格 97.485 超过涨跌停版限制
2015-11-10 10:32:00.513    【下单】TF12 价99.224998 量10 买卖1 类型0 开平0 账户606959 Formula 1
2015-11-10 10:32:00.513    【指令】收到回报指令 ID = -1863906480
2015-11-10 10:32:00.528    【下单】T12 价99.230003 量7 买卖0 类型0 开平0 账户606959 Formula 1
2015-11-10 10:32:00.528    【指令】收到回报指令 ID = -1863906480
2015-11-10 10:32:00.528    【指令】收到回报指令 ID = -1863906480
2015-11-10 10:32:00.528    【指令】收到成交回报指令 ORDERID = -1863906480
2015-11-10 10:32:00.560    【回报】606959 : T1512 - 已报单 7 价格:97.490 开 买
2015-11-10 10:32:00.560    【回报】606959 : T1512 - 已成交 3 价格:97.490 开 买
2015-11-10 10:32:00.560    【指令】收到回报指令 ID = -1863906480
2015-11-10 10:32:00.575    【指令】收到成交回报指令 ORDERID = -1863906480
2015-11-10 10:32:00.591    【回报】606959 : T1512 - 已成交 4 价格:97.490 开 买
2015-11-10 10:32:00.591    【回报】606959 : T1512 - 全部成交 7
2015-11-10 10:32:00.591    【指令】收到回报指令 ID = -1863906479
2015-11-10 10:32:00.606    【回报】606959 : TF1512 - 已报单 10 价格:99.225 开 卖
2015-11-10 10:32:00.606    【指令】收到回报指令 ID = -1863906479
2015-11-10 10:32:00.606    【指令】收到回报指令 ID = -1863906479
2015-11-10 10:32:00.622    【指令】收到成交回报指令 ORDERID = -1863906479
2015-11-10 10:32:00.638    【回报】606959 : TF1512 - 已成交 5 价格:99.225 开 卖
2015-11-10 10:32:00.638    【指令】收到回报指令 ID = -1863906479
2015-11-10 10:32:00.638    【指令】收到成交回报指令 ORDERID = -1863906479
2015-11-10 10:32:00.669    【回报】606959 : TF1512 - 已成交 5 价格:99.225 开 卖
2015-11-10 10:32:00.669    【回报】606959 : TF1512 - 全部成交 10
2015-11-10 10:32:00.684    【指令】收到回报指令 ID = -1863906478
2015-11-10 10:32:00.684    【回报】606959 : T1512 - 已报单 7 价格:99.230 开 买
2015-11-10 10:32:00.700    【指令】收到回报指令 ID = -1863906478
2015-11-10 10:32:00.700    【指令】收到回报指令 ID = -1863906478
2015-11-10 10:32:00.716    【指令】收到成交回报指令 ORDERID = -1863906478
2015-11-10 10:32:00.716    【回报】606959 : T1512 - 已成交 3 价格:97.490 开 买
2015-11-10 10:32:00.716    【指令】收到回报指令 ID = -1863906478
2015-11-10 10:32:00.731    【指令】收到成交回报指令 ORDERID = -1863906478
2015-11-10 10:32:00.747    【回报】606959 : T1512 - 已成交 4 价格:97.490 开 买
2015-11-10 10:32:00.747    【回报】606959 : T1512 - 全部成交 7
2015-11-10 10:32:20.541    【后台】T00 运行结束
2015-11-10 10:32:20.556    【后台】TF00 运行结束
2015-11-10 10:32:40.806    【后台】T00 运行结束
2015-11-10 10:32:40.822    【后台】TF00 运行结束
再请问,刚才T1512策略规定的下单7手,现在成交14手,也是上面没指定价格的原因?

--  作者:jinzhe
--  发布时间:2015/11/10 10:53:50
--  
你是不是一个策略同时监控了两个品种一起跑?这相当于下两次单了
--  作者:plsf99
--  发布时间:2015/11/10 10:59:42
--  
是同时监控两品种,那为什么TF不多下单?后台到底要怎么设定监控品种?